What AI video enhancers 2026 actually fix
Before you spend anything, understand the job. AI video enhancers 2026 do four distinct things, and each one is a separate model with separate strengths:
Upscaling. This is the headline feature. The tool takes 480p or 720p source and reconstructs a 1080p or 4K frame by predicting detail that isn't really there. Topaz calls its models Proteus, Iris, Gaia and Theia. AVCLabs uses a transformer-based pipeline. HitPaw has an animation model that handles flat colors and hard lines better than anything else in this list. Every serious AI video upscaler claims 4K output; the difference is how much edge haloing and flicker you get in motion. And if your job is to upscale old video footage shot on tape or an early smartphone, the desktop tools are the only ones worth your time — the online freebies stretch pixels and call it AI.
Denoising and deblurring. Old tape and phone footage carry grain, compression artifacts and motion blur. The denoise pass cleans the grain *before* upscaling — run it after and you're just sharpening noise. This is the single biggest quality lever, and it's why the "AI" in these tools matters. Bicubic scaling can't do this.
Deinterlacing. If your footage came from a camcorder or TV capture, every frame is actually two half-frames scanned at different times. Interlaced video looks like a comb on modern screens. All three desktop tools deinterlace; CapCut mostly doesn't.
Frame interpolation. This creates new frames between existing ones — 24fps footage becomes 60fps, which is what you want for smooth slow motion from standard-rate source. Topaz's Chronos and Apollo models are the reference here; HitPaw and AVCLabs have interpolation models too, but their output is softer on fast motion.
Now the hard truth nobody puts in a feature list: an enhancer cannot invent detail that the source never contained. A 320p YouTube rip that's been re-encoded three times is mostly gone. Upscaling it gives you a bigger, blurrier file. The tools work best on footage with real structure — VHS, MiniDV, 1080p phone footage, AI-generated clips — not on compressed garbage. If you're trying to fix a WhatsApp-forwarded video, stop now. That's not what video restoration software does.

Topaz Video AI — the quality benchmark, if your GPU can take it
Topaz Video AI is the professional standard for upscaling and restoration, and every other product in this category positions itself against it. It runs entirely on your machine — nothing leaves your computer, which matters if the footage is a client's. It upscales to 8K, deinterlaces, denoises, deblurs, stabilizes, and interpolates frames, and its temporal models keep frames consistent so you don't get the flicker that image-based upscalers produce when applied to video.
Topaz Video AI pricing is the most important number here: $299 one-time, which includes a year of model updates. After that, the software keeps working forever; you only pay again ($99/year) if you want newer models. Compare that to the $1,200 to $2,400 an hour a restoration service charges, and the license pays for itself on the first real job. That's not marketing math, that's the price list of actual restoration vendors I checked.
The catch is hardware. Topaz recommends an NVIDIA GPU with at least 4GB of VRAM; an RTX 3060 or better is the practical floor. Apple Silicon Macs work and perform well, but a MacBook Air will crawl on 4K output. If you want an AI video enhancer for Mac with serious power, budget for an M-series Pro or Max chip or an external GPU. Integrated graphics will technically run, but a 10-minute clip can take hours — preview before committing, and don't skip the grain-removal pass.
Who should buy it: anyone with recurring restoration work — wedding editors delivering 4K from 1080p source, archivists, people monetizing old footage libraries. Who shouldn't: someone with one family tape and a laptop without a discrete GPU. You'd be buying a race car for a grocery run. AVCLabs Video Enhancer AI — the easier rival with the better faces
AVCLabs is the main alternative, and the direct Topaz Video AI vs AVCLabs comparison comes down to workflow versus ceiling. AVCLabs runs on Windows, macOS, and has a cloud version — no GPU required if you use the cloud tier. Its interface is simpler than Topaz's: import, pick a model, export. Its standout is face refinement: in side-by-side tests of a blurry 360p home video, AVCLabs reconstructed facial features that other tools turned into smooth blobs.
Pricing: $39.95/month, $119.95/year (frequently discounted to about $96), or a perpetual license that lists at $299.90 but routinely drops to $149.90 on sale. There's a free version with a watermarked 30-second export limit, so you can test your actual footage before paying. The free trial alone makes it worth installing if you're comparing tools.
The tradeoffs: quality on extreme restoration is a notch below Topaz in most shootouts, especially on film grain and motion. Fast-moving scenes can show edge smoothing artifacts. And the subscription price is steep if you only have one project — the perpetual license on sale is the only plan that makes sense for a one-off.
HitPaw Video Enhancer — for beginners and anime
HitPaw Video Enhancer (now branded VikPea) is the one-click option. Upload, pick a model, preview three seconds, export. It has specialized models — General Denoise, Face, Animation, Colorize, Color Enhancement, Frame Interpolation, Stabilize, Low-light — and its animation model is genuinely good, often beating Topaz on flat-color content like cartoons and game captures. For family archivists colorizing black-and-white home movies, the Colorize model does a respectable job with zero learning curve.
Pricing is the weak point: $42.99/month, $99.99/year, or $349.99 lifetime — the most expensive perpetual license in this comparison, and there's no free export at all, just a 3-second preview. One license covers one PC. HitPaw also can't apply multiple models in one pass; upscaling and colorizing means running the video twice.
Who should buy it: non-technical users, anime fans, and people doing one-off family restorations who won't touch advanced settings. Who shouldn't: anyone processing more than a few clips, because the price and the double-pass workflow add up fast.
CapCut — the free option you already have
CapCut is not a restoration tool. It's a social video editor with light enhancement features — sharpen, denoise, and 4K upscaling presets inside its Magic Studio. But if your goal is "make this clip look less terrible for a Reel," it's genuinely the best value: the free tier exports up to 1080p with watermarks on some premium effects, and CapCut Pro runs about $10 to $20 per month depending on region and billing cycle (pricing was restructured in May 2025, so check capcut.com rather than trusting any third-party list).
The limits are real: no serious deinterlacing, no frame interpolation beyond basic slow-motion, and upscaling quality is a distant third behind the desktop tools. Cost math: what "restore old home videos with AI" really costs
Let me put real numbers on this, because the pricing pages hide the actual economics. A typical 10-minute 1080p home video with moderate noise, sent to a professional service, runs $150 to $400 depending on the vendor — that's the range I found across current restoration price lists, from $5.50/minute basic cleanup to $12.50/minute 4K restoration. VHS-grade transfer and cleanup runs $40 per hour of tape at the budget end. Film archives charge far more.
Now run that same 10-minute clip through Topaz on an RTX 3060: roughly 30 to 60 minutes of render time, some electricity, and if you already own the license, essentially $0 per job. The license amortizes to near-zero after your first full restoration. If you're restoring a wedding archive or a deceased parent's tape collection — 10, 20, 50 hours of footage — the professional route is $5,000 to $50,000. The software route is $299 once, plus your GPU and your time. That's the entire argument for buying one of these tools, and it's why this category exists at all.
The hidden cost is your GPU. If you don't own one with decent VRAM, the cheapest real path is AVCLabs' cloud tier (no hardware needed) or buying a used RTX 3060 before you buy the software. A $200 used GPU plus a $299 license still beats $5,000 of professional restoration on a 50-tape project.
How to enhance low quality video without losing your weekend
If you want to actually upscale video to 4K or fix a blurry clip, the workflow is the same across all three desktop tools:
- Digitize first. If your source is tape, capture it at the highest quality your deck supports *before* any enhancement. Enhancement can't recover what the capture step threw away.
- Denoise before you upscale. Grain removal first, then upscaling. The reverse order just sharpens the noise. This is the #1 amateur mistake.
- Preview on a 10-second slice. Render a short section with your chosen model before committing to a full export. A wrong setting on a 10-minute clip wastes 30 to 90 minutes of GPU time.
- Match the model to the content. Animation footage wants an animation model. Interlaced camcorder tape wants a deinterlace model first. Faces in low resolution want a face model. The generic "upscale" preset is the worst option for everything.
- Export at the resolution you'll actually use. 1080p → 4K is where the visible gain lives. 4K → 8K is mostly wasted for YouTube and phones.
That's the whole process. Thirty minutes to learn, then it's batch work — load a folder, apply the same settings, walk away.

Can AI restore old home videos with AI? I mean, really restore them?
Within limits. AI can remove grain, deinterlace, stabilize shake, sharpen faces, and upscale old home videos with AI to 4K — that's real and impressive on tape or MiniDV source. It cannot bring back detail that was never recorded, and heavily compressed re-encoded files stay mushy no matter what you pay. The degradation ceiling is the source tape's generation, not the software's skill.

Should I use an enhancer or an editor?
Both, in that order. Enhance first (denoise, deinterlace, upscale), then edit (cut, caption, export). Running an editor's built-in upscale on already-degraded footage gives you a bigger version of the same problem.
